Regular out-patient rehab is usually a less expensive choice to more comprehensive outpatient centers or inpatient rehabilitation, and is the lowest intensity of formal substance abuse treatment around in Hamtramck. Some people are in rehab for their first time and have picked regular outpatient because of the cost and commitment to time wise and scheduling because of work, school or other obligations. In some cases, regular outpatient is a step down from rehab in a more intense outpatient program such as a partial hospitalization or in-patient facility.
Regular outpatient rehabilitation options usually involve individual and group counseling services occurring once or twice a week. Centers which include a wider range of services may include counseling (behavioral therapy) to assist with relapse prevention and dual diagnosis services to help address co-occurring substance abuse and mental health disorders. The length of time a client stays involved in rehab can change from client to client, and a client's improvement can be judged from time to time and an extension of rehab can be recommended based on these evaluations.
In many cases, a regular outpatient treatment facility is going to be lacking in intensity for a client who is facing a bad alcohol and drug issue and has not gone to rehab before or has relapsed after prior outpatient recovery.
